
Sonagara
Scientific name: Sonagara
Sonagara
Scientific name: Sonagara


Species of Sonagara


Scientific Classification

Phylum
Arthropods Class
Bugs Order
Moths and butterflies Family
Picture-winged leaf moths Genus
Sonagara